29 Nov International Crops Research Institute for the Semi-Arid Tropics (ICRISAT) Patancheru 502324, Telangana, India
29 Nov International Livestock Research Institute (ILRI) P.O. Box 30709, GPO 00100, Nairobi, Kenya | ILRI, Old Naivasha Road, near Uthiru, Nairobi, Kenya
29 Nov International Institute of Tropical Agriculture (IITA-CGIAR) PMB 5320, Oyo Road, Ibadan 200001, Oyo State, Nigeria
29 Nov Yieldwise Seed Company ROAD 29, JERE AZARA IRRIGATION SCHEME, JERE KAGARKO L.G.A, Kaduna State, Nigeria